Electron perpendicular viscosity in Braginskii's equations
- General Atomics, P.O. Box 85608, San Diego, California 92186-5608 (United States)
The viscosity coefficient of the electron perpendicular stress tensor in Braginskii's theory is corrected by the addition of a term of the same order of magnitude, through the inclusion of a term beyond pitch angle scattering in the mass-ratio expansion of the electron-ion collision operator.
